Director of Product Development
What Does a Professional in this Career Do?
A Director of Product Development is responsible for directing the overall product development of a business. This may include of developing the company strategy for the product, and collaborating with other directors from the engineering, marketing, sales, and operations departments in order to ensure that the strategy for the product aligns across the business.

Education and Experience
Posted Director of Product Development jobs typically require the following level of education. The numbers below are based on job postings in the United States from the past year. Not all job postings list education requirements.
Education Level | Percentage |
---|---|
Associate's Degree | 0% |
Bachelor's Degree | 54.35% |
Master's Degree | 32.54% |
Doctoral Degree | 9.38% |
Other | 2.34% |
Posted Director of Product Development jobs typically require the following number of years of experience. The numbers below are based on job postings in the United States from the past year. Not all job postings list experience requirements.
Years of Experience | Percentage |
---|---|
0 to 2 years | 4.47% |
3 to 5 years | 24.27% |
6 to 8 years | 28.59% |
9+ years | 42.67% |
